Directory Entry : Founded in 1967 as the Environmental Defense Fund, we tackle the most serious environmental problem...a scrappy group of scientists and a lawyer on Long Island, New York, fighting to save osprey from the toxic pesticide DDT. Using scientific evidence, our founders got DDT banned nationwide. Today, we’re one of the world's leading environmental organizations. Environmental Defense Action Fund (EDAF) is the political affairs arm of Environmental Defense Fund.  EDAF is guided by scientific evaluation of environmental problems, and the solutions we advocate will be based on science, even when it leads in unfamiliar directions.  We work to create solutions that win lasting economic and social support because they are nonpartisan, cost-effective and fair.  As a 501(c)(4) organization, Environmental Defense Action Fund is not limited in what it can spend to promote legislative environmental solutions.
